Deep Byrds Jams

At this point in the Byrds' career (1970), Roger McGuinn had lead his fans through so many musical twists and turns (folk, pop, psych, country)... and all in the expanse of 6 years. Bands don't change this radically anymore. I can't imagine who was showing up for a Byrds concert in 1970. But if they did show up, they must have had their mynds blown with this nearly 10 minute instrumental version of Eight Miles High. The dude at 7:40 is channeling a proto-David Byrne dance.
